Hioki current sensors are best-in-class devices for use with power meters, PQAs and Memory HiCorders. The CT9667 series are flexible Rogowski type AC sensors comprising of 3 different models in various loop diameter sizes from 100 to 254 mm. The 100mm and 180mm diameter sensor also feature extra thin cables for easier looping around complicated wiring. All 3 sensors 500A/5000A ranges, making them ideal for measuring large load current.

  • CAT IV 600 V, CAT III 1000 V
  • Thinner cables are easy to use in confined spaces and with complicated wiring
  • Shaped so that it’s easy to route through complex wiring
  • Easily supports large current measurements up to 5000 A
  • Wide 10 Hz to 20 kHz band with excellent frequency characteristics
  • Choose from three conductor diameter sizes
  • Combine with Hioki power meters or Memory HiCorders
  • Rated input current: 5000 A AC/ 500 A AC
  • Max. allowable input: 10000 A continuous (45 to 66 Hz, requires derating at frequency)
  • Bandwidth: 10 Hz to 20 kHz (±3dB)
  • Amplitude and phase accuracy:
    • ±2 % rdg. ±0.3 % f.s. (45 to 66 Hz, at center of flexible loop)
    • Phase: ±1 deg (45 to 66 Hz)

    >

  • Output voltage:
    • 500 mV AC/f.s. (0.1 mV AC/A) at 5000 A range
    • 500 mV AC/f.s. (1 mV AC/A) at 500 A range

    >

  • Max. rated voltage to earth: 1000 V AC (CAT III), 600 V AC (CAT IV)
